Join the clubBalcones Texas "1" Single Malt Whisky is a non-chill-filtered, 53% ABV bottle of Lone-Star awesomeness. You just have to love the charming, independent, and rebellious spirit of Texas. Balcones Distilling is based in Waco — just about half way between Dallas and Austin.
Texas is a big state, and they like everything big… big steaks, big trucks, big hats, and big flavors. Balcones is still a small distillery (thank goodness!), but it is filled with big ideas.
They hand-make a range of Whiskies, Rums, and mysterious fiddly things, all of which are unabashedly crafted with the big flavors they love.
But just because these Texas Spirits stand up and yell "Yeee-Haw!" doesn’t mean they they don’t have all the serious craftsmanship and quality you get in the big city or the fancy-dancy capitals of Europe. These Spirits are top notch, and they have the awards to prove it.

Balcones has the tallest copper pot stills in the world, featuring proprietary helical lyne arms that were designed and built by the famed Forsyths of Scotland.
